Yamaha YZF750 Tech 21 Fujimi
After a while e new WIP for 2 bikes, one fo me and another fro a friend of mine.
There is not too much to see but this kit has positive and negative sides.... Positive is detailing, nuts, bolts it's all there. Negative the fujimi engineering. All the tubes connections are missing, the plastic is that kind of "glass" plastic. The building takes a lot of care and putty as you can see from this picture. I will not fill the gap as these kits will be quite out of the box, and I will spend my time on visible details. For the moment a lot of metallic shades as per instructions is all silver or chrome silver so using different colors is fundamental |

Re: Yamaha YZF750 Tech 21 Fujimi
I'm using Zero piant....
I bought the light blue when it was available, and sent the original decal to Hiroboy to have the dark blue matched. They asked me for the decals....So they sent me a free of charge bottle of dark blue, but the color was wrong (so the decals) and they retired the tech 21 colors. I made the "lavander" mixing their light blue, galuoises blu and ferrari red... It seems to be the best I could do..... |
